SUMMARY:Wolf Trap Park Pop Ups: Cantaré
DESCRIPTION:Tune in for a Park Pop-Up on July 25 with a streaming performance and Wolf Trap debut of Cantar . Plan to spend some time with stellar music in your own living room!\n\n\n\nWolf Trap's virtual Park Pop-Up series brings music and more straight to your home. Featuring local area artists\, Park Pop-Up performances are recorded live at Wolf Trap National Park for the Performing Arts and later streamed online. A part of Wolf Trap Sessions\, these pre-recorded Park Pop-Ups bring a small piece of summer to your home.\n\n\n\nPROGRAM \n"Mucha M sica"\n\n"Xanahar "\n\n"Adi s"\n\n\n\nARTISTS\n\nCecilia Esquivel\, vocals and small percussion\n\nDani Cortaza\, guitar\n\nMart n Z  iga\, percussion\n\n\n\nABOUT CANTAR \n\nBased in the Washington\, D.C. metropolitan area\, Cantar 's mission is to offer high-quality musical performances that also inform audiences about Latin American geography\, history\, and culture.\n\n\n\nCantar  has released four recordings three albums for children including Baila para Gozar (2002)\, Al Agua Pato (2005)\,  and Mucha M sica (2014)\, as well as one album for adult audiences titled Evaluna by Cantar  and Friends (2005). In addition\, in 2006 Cantar  recorded the companion CD for the award-winning book Arrorr  mi Ni o: Latino Lullabies and Gentle Games by renowned children's author and illustrator Lulu Delacre. This engaging educational approach has become popular in schools\, libraries\, museums\, government agencies\, and a variety of other public and private venues.
